MONITORING ALTERNATIVE 9 <br /> Monitoring alternative 9 is part of the proposed amendments to <br /> the Underground Storage Tank Regulations. Assuming these <br /> regulations are adopted, this alternative would be applicable. <br /> Implementation of this monitoring alternative will require Daily <br /> Inventory Reconciliation, Rate of Volume Change testing, Annual <br /> Tank Integrity testing, and Pipeline Leak detection. If this <br /> monitoring alternative is chosen, implementation should be <br /> carried out as follows: <br /> 1) Perform the initial tank integrity test/tests to confirm that <br /> the tank/tanks do/does not leak at the time of implementation <br /> of the monitoring alternative. Integrity testing must be <br /> done within one year prior to implementation of the <br /> monitoring alternative. Based on information obtained from <br /> facility personnel all/the tanks/tank at this facility have <br /> passed an integrity test within the last year. <br /> 2) Daily Inventory Reconciliation shall be accomplished using a <br /> tank level monitor (automated liquid level monitoring <br /> equipment) . This tank level monitor shall be capable of <br /> monitoring the volume of fuel in the tank and performing the <br /> required rate of volume change testing. The tank level <br /> monitor shall meet the minimum requirements as specified in <br /> Section 2641, Subsection C-9 (D and E) of the proposed <br /> amendments to the Underground Storage Tank Regulations <br /> Allowable daily inventory variation and the frequency of rate <br /> of volume change testing shall be dependent upon which <br /> monitoring schedule is chosen from Section 2641 Table 4 . 3 . <br /> Further refinement of the specifications required for <br /> complying with this monitoring alternative are outlined in <br /> Section 2641 Monitor Alternative 9 . Specifications <br /> regarding three types of tank level monitors, each of which <br /> should be suitable for use at this facility, are attached at <br /> the end of this package. <br /> 3 Implementation of this monitoring alternative will require <br /> annual calibration of flow meters by the State of California <br /> Bureau of Weights and Measures. <br /> 4) Pipeline leak detection requirements can be accomplished by <br /> visual inspection since the method of product delivery is by <br /> suction pump. Monitoring shall be as described in Appendix <br /> II of the Underground Storage Tank Regulations. <br /> 5) Tank integrity testing to determine that total product loss <br /> from the tank does not exceed 0. 05 gallons per hour, shall be <br /> performed every three years. Integrity testing shall be <br /> carried out as specified in Section 2643 of the Underground <br /> Storage Tank Regulations. <br />
